Whenever students are learning a new grammar pattern, you’ll see a range of understanding which extends from zero to fluent. The goal is fluency, not just understanding, or being able to fill in some blanks. Each lesson should review previous aspects of the past tense the students have learned. There are a few different aspects students will need to be familiar with when they are learning the past simple tense.Įach part can be made into a lesson.
